crash.software
Projects
Pull Requests
Issues
Builds
CVE-2022-27666
Code
Files
Commits
Branches
Tags
Pull Requests
Code Comments
Code Compare
Issues
List
Boards
Milestones
Builds
Statistics
Contributions
Source Lines
Child Projects
Projects
STRLCPY
CVE-2022-27666
Files
🤬
Sign In
main
ROOT
/
libfuse
/
fuse_lowlevel.h
Search
History
2101 lines
|
ISO-8859-1
|
66 KB
Blame
Outline
2
4
8
No wrap
Soft wrap
Outline
FUSE_LOWLEVEL_H_
FUSE_ROOT_ID
FUSE_SET_ATTR_MODE
FUSE_SET_ATTR_UID
FUSE_SET_ATTR_GID
FUSE_SET_ATTR_SIZE
FUSE_SET_ATTR_ATIME
FUSE_SET_ATTR_MTIME
FUSE_SET_ATTR_ATIME_NOW
FUSE_SET_ATTR_MTIME_NOW
FUSE_SET_ATTR_CTIME
fuse_session_loop_mt
(
se,clone_fd
)
fuse_ino_t
:
uint64_t
fuse_req_t
:
struct fuse_req*
fuse_entry_param
ino
:
fuse_ino_t
generation
:
uint64_t
attr
:
struct stat
attr_timeout
:
double
entry_timeout
:
double
fuse_ctx
uid
:
uid_t
gid
:
gid_t
pid
:
pid_t
umask
:
mode_t
fuse_forget_data
ino
:
fuse_ino_t
nlookup
:
uint64_t
fuse_lowlevel_ops
init
:
void(*)(void*,struct fuse_conn_info*)
destroy
:
void(*)(void*)
lookup
:
void(*)(fuse_req_t,fuse_ino_t,const char*)
forget
:
void(*)(fuse_req_t,fuse_ino_t,uint64_t)
getattr
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
setattr
:
void(*)(fuse_req_t,fuse_ino_t,struct stat*,int,struct fuse_file_info*)
readlink
:
void(*)(fuse_req_t,fuse_ino_t)
mknod
:
void(*)(fuse_req_t,fuse_ino_t,const char*,mode_t,dev_t)
mkdir
:
void(*)(fuse_req_t,fuse_ino_t,const char*,mode_t)
unlink
:
void(*)(fuse_req_t,fuse_ino_t,const char*)
rmdir
:
void(*)(fuse_req_t,fuse_ino_t,const char*)
symlink
:
void(*)(fuse_req_t,const char*,fuse_ino_t,const char*)
rename
:
void(*)(fuse_req_t,fuse_ino_t,const char*,fuse_ino_t,const char*,unsigned int)
link
:
void(*)(fuse_req_t,fuse_ino_t,fuse_ino_t,const char*)
open
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
read
:
void(*)(fuse_req_t,fuse_ino_t,size_t,off_t,struct fuse_file_info*)
write
:
void(*)(fuse_req_t,fuse_ino_t,const char*,size_t,off_t,struct fuse_file_info*)
flush
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
release
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
fsync
:
void(*)(fuse_req_t,fuse_ino_t,int,struct fuse_file_info*)
opendir
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
readdir
:
void(*)(fuse_req_t,fuse_ino_t,size_t,off_t,struct fuse_file_info*)
releasedir
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*)
fsyncdir
:
void(*)(fuse_req_t,fuse_ino_t,int,struct fuse_file_info*)
statfs
:
void(*)(fuse_req_t,fuse_ino_t)
setxattr
:
void(*)(fuse_req_t,fuse_ino_t,const char*,const char*,size_t,int)
getxattr
:
void(*)(fuse_req_t,fuse_ino_t,const char*,size_t)
listxattr
:
void(*)(fuse_req_t,fuse_ino_t,size_t)
removexattr
:
void(*)(fuse_req_t,fuse_ino_t,const char*)
access
:
void(*)(fuse_req_t,fuse_ino_t,int)
create
:
void(*)(fuse_req_t,fuse_ino_t,const char*,mode_t,struct fuse_file_info*)
getlk
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*,struct flock*)
setlk
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*,struct flock*,int)
bmap
:
void(*)(fuse_req_t,fuse_ino_t,size_t,uint64_t)
ioctl
:
void(*)(fuse_req_t,fuse_ino_t,int,void*,struct fuse_file_info*,unsigned,const void*,size_t,size_t)
poll
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*,struct fuse_pollhandle*)
write_buf
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_bufvec*,off_t,struct fuse_file_info*)
retrieve_reply
:
void(*)(fuse_req_t,void*,fuse_ino_t,off_t,struct fuse_bufvec*)
forget_multi
:
void(*)(fuse_req_t,size_t,struct fuse_forget_data*)
flock
:
void(*)(fuse_req_t,fuse_ino_t,struct fuse_file_info*,int)
fallocate
:
void(*)(fuse_req_t,fuse_ino_t,int,off_t,off_t,struct fuse_file_info*)
readdirplus
:
void(*)(fuse_req_t,fuse_ino_t,size_t,off_t,struct fuse_file_info*)
copy_file_range
:
void(*)(fuse_req_t,fuse_ino_t,off_t,struct fuse_file_info*,fuse_ino_t,off_t,struct fuse_file_info*,size_t,int)
lseek
:
void(*)(fuse_req_t,fuse_ino_t,off_t,int,struct fuse_file_info*)
fuse_reply_err
(
fuse_req_t,int
)
:
int
fuse_reply_none
(
fuse_req_t
)
:
void
fuse_reply_entry
(
fuse_req_t,const struct fuse_entry_param*
)
:
int
fuse_reply_create
(
fuse_req_t,const struct fuse_entry_param*,const struct fuse_file_info*
)
:
int
fuse_reply_attr
(
fuse_req_t,const struct stat*,double
)
:
int
fuse_reply_readlink
(
fuse_req_t,const char*
)
:
int
fuse_reply_open
(
fuse_req_t,const struct fuse_file_info*
)
:
int
fuse_reply_write
(
fuse_req_t,size_t
)
:
int
fuse_reply_buf
(
fuse_req_t,const char*,size_t
)
:
int
fuse_reply_data
(
fuse_req_t,struct fuse_bufvec*,enum fuse_buf_copy_flags
)
:
int
fuse_reply_iov
(
fuse_req_t,const struct iovec*,int
)
:
int
fuse_reply_statfs
(
fuse_req_t,const struct statvfs*
)
:
int
fuse_reply_xattr
(
fuse_req_t,size_t
)
:
int
fuse_reply_lock
(
fuse_req_t,const struct flock*
)
:
int
fuse_reply_bmap
(
fuse_req_t,uint64_t
)
:
int
fuse_reply_ioctl_retry
(
fuse_req_t,const struct iovec*,size_t,const struct iovec*,size_t
)
:
int
fuse_reply_ioctl
(
fuse_req_t,int,const void*,size_t
)
:
int
fuse_reply_ioctl_iov
(
fuse_req_t,int,const struct iovec*,int
)
:
int
fuse_reply_poll
(
fuse_req_t,unsigned
)
:
int
fuse_reply_lseek
(
fuse_req_t,off_t
)
:
int
fuse_lowlevel_notify_poll
(
struct fuse_pollhandle*
)
:
int
fuse_lowlevel_notify_inval_inode
(
struct fuse_session*,fuse_ino_t,off_t,off_t
)
:
int
fuse_lowlevel_notify_inval_entry
(
struct fuse_session*,fuse_ino_t,const char*,size_t
)
:
int
fuse_lowlevel_notify_delete
(
struct fuse_session*,fuse_ino_t,fuse_ino_t,const char*,size_t
)
:
int
fuse_lowlevel_notify_store
(
struct fuse_session*,fuse_ino_t,off_t,struct fuse_bufvec*,enum fuse_buf_copy_flags
)
:
int
fuse_lowlevel_notify_retrieve
(
struct fuse_session*,fuse_ino_t,size_t,off_t,void*
)
:
int
fuse_req_userdata
(
fuse_req_t
)
:
void*
fuse_req_ctx
(
fuse_req_t
)
:
const struct fuse_ctx*
fuse_req_getgroups
(
fuse_req_t,int,gid_t[]
)
:
int
fuse_interrupt_func_t
:
void(*)(fuse_req_t,void*)
fuse_req_interrupt_func
(
fuse_req_t,fuse_interrupt_func_t,void*
)
:
void
fuse_req_interrupted
(
fuse_req_t
)
:
int
fuse_lowlevel_version
(
void
)
:
void
fuse_lowlevel_help
(
void
)
:
void
fuse_cmdline_help
(
void
)
:
void
fuse_cmdline_opts
singlethread
:
int
foreground
:
int
debug
:
int
nodefault_subtype
:
int
mountpoint
:
char*
show_version
:
int
show_help
:
int
clone_fd
:
int
max_idle_threads
:
unsigned int
fuse_parse_cmdline
(
struct fuse_args*,struct fuse_cmdline_opts*
)
:
int
fuse_session_new
(
struct fuse_args*,const struct fuse_lowlevel_ops*,size_t,void*
)
:
struct fuse_session*
fuse_session_mount
(
struct fuse_session*,const char*
)
:
int
fuse_session_loop
(
struct fuse_session*
)
:
int
fuse_session_loop_mt_31
(
struct fuse_session*,int
)
:
int
fuse_session_exit
(
struct fuse_session*
)
:
void
fuse_session_reset
(
struct fuse_session*
)
:
void
fuse_session_exited
(
struct fuse_session*
)
:
int
fuse_session_unmount
(
struct fuse_session*
)
:
void
fuse_session_destroy
(
struct fuse_session*
)
:
void
fuse_session_fd
(
struct fuse_session*
)
:
int
fuse_session_process_buf
(
struct fuse_session*,const struct fuse_buf*
)
:
void
fuse_session_receive_buf
(
struct fuse_session*,struct fuse_buf*
)
:
int
All occurrences
Please wait...
Page is in error, reload to recover